Transaction 905f36de84d3c13caf3fc687c6fdd7f5d5e031b4fe0cacce02210df931123506
1 Input
1 Output
-
905f36de84d3c13caf3fc687c6fdd7f5d5e031b4fe0cacce02210df931123506:0
- value
- 2523305690961
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 efc9596b32f51f73bd7f75b7ffae84b21f6bcc1192c84fc0decd84f4c3d8394d
- address
- ltc1galy4j6ej750h80tlwkmllt5ykg0khnq3jtyylsx7ekz0fs7c89xsvmzax3